Chef has the ability to tag systems, etc, via knife or it can be done via Automate. What seems to be missing is the ability to say "show me all the nodes with a specific tag". That strikes me as being a logical thing for people using tagging to want to do. We use tagging a lot while patching systems, for example, and there's no easy way to find out what has the correct tag and what doesn't. A power user could make a script to do that, but there has to be an easy way for the non-power user to do this.
Chef tag is available in the client run reports. If nodes are tagged with it, you will be able to filter them in client run report. Am marking this idea as already possible. If you have any concerns please reach out to your respective account manager or customer architect for further guidance.
